Vaire Computing’s Ice River chip reuses energy and cuts energy waste in proof of concept test

zeeforce
3 Min Read




  • Vaire Computing’s Ice River chip reuses energy, cutting power by around 30 percent
  • Leaders at the startup describe the test as proof of concept for reversible logic
  • Despite the result, the chip is unlikely to convince hyperscale operators at this stage

An experimental chip designed by a London startup has reached the proof of concept stage, showing it can reuse part of the energy it consumes.

Vaire Computing hopes its work will go some way to addressing the rising energy demand from artificial intelligence systems, although questions remain about whether such technology will appeal to hyperscale operators who are working on their own energy-taming solutions.
